Index: external-module-compat.h
===================================================================
--- external-module-compat.h (revision 4381)
+++ external-module-compat.h (working copy)
@@ -72,6 +72,27 @@
* The cpu hotplug stubs are broken if !CONFIG_CPU_HOTPLUG
*/
+#if LINUX_VERSION_CODE <= KERNEL_VERSION(2,6,15)
+#define DEFINE_MUTEX(a) DECLARE_MUTEX(a)
+#define mutex_lock_interruptible(a) down_interruptible(a)
+#define mutex_unlock(a) up(a)
+#define mutex_lock(a) down(a)
+#define mutex_init(a) init_MUTEX(a)
+#define mutex_trylock(a) down_trylock(a)
+#endif
+
+#if LINUX_VERSION_CODE < KERNEL_VERSION(2,6,14)
+#ifndef kzalloc
+#define kzalloc(size,flags) \
+({ \
+ void *__ret = kmalloc(size, flags); \
+ if (__ret)
+ memset(__ret, 0, size);
+ __ret;
+})
+#endif
+#endif
+
